About The Museum of Piping
With over 300 years of piping heritage, The Museum of Piping at The National Piping Centre has a wealth of information and exhibits on the Great Highland Bagpipe. As the most authoritative exhibition of piping in the world, the collection boasts many rare and interesting objects such as, the oldest surviving chanter of the Highland bagpipe as well as bagpipes from all over Britain and Europe.
